- The distance between Cimone Mountain, Italy and Haeju, South Korea is approximately 8,784 km or 5,459 mi.
- To reach Cimone Mountain in this distance one would set out from Haeju bearing 318.5°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Cimone Mountain bearing 226.7° or SW .
- Cimone Mountain has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as Haeju has a hot summer continental climate with dry winters (Dwa).
- Cimone Mountain is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ome whereas Haeju is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 8.3 °C (14.9°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 14.5 °C (26.1°F) less in Cimone Mountain.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 415.3 mm (16.4 in) less which is equivalent to 415.3 l/m² (10.19 US gal/ft²) or 4,153,000 l/ha (443,983 US gal/ac) less. About 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 6.2° lower in Cimone Mountain than in Haeju.
